The Samsung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T) is slightly better than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7, having a global score of 65 against 64.8. Both of these tablets use Android OS, but Samsung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T) has a more recent 4.1 version while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7 has Android 4.0.4, so it gives you a lot of extra features. The Samsung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T) design is newer, but noticeably heavier and thicker than the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7.
The Samsung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T) features a little better processing power than Galaxy Tab 7.7, and although they both have a Dual-Core processor and a 1 GB RAM, the Samsung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T) also has a much better 400 megahertz graphics processing unit. Galaxy Tab 7.7 counts with a little sharper screen than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T), because although it has a much smaller screen, and they both have the same resolution of 800 x 1280px, the Galaxy Tab 7.7 also counts with more pixels per inch in the display.
Galaxy Tab 7.7 shoots just a bit better photos and videos than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T). They have a back camera with a 3 MP resolution, the same 1280x720 (HD) video quality and the same video frame rate.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7 counts with a much greater memory capacity to install applications and games than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T), and although they both have a SD card slot that admits a maximum of 32 GB, the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7 also has 64 GB internal memory capacity.
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T) has a much better battery life than Samsung Galaxy Tab 7.7, because it has 7000mAh of battery capacity.
In addition to being the best tablet of the ones in this comparison, the Samsung Galaxy Tab 2 10.1 (AT&T) is also very cheap compared to the other ones.
